"When I got started, there wasn't much diversity at all." The young DJ discusses Australia's QTBIPOC community, debuting at Dekmantel and more live from Pitch Festival. Australian talent Charlotte Frimpong, the DJ better known as C.FRIM, has become one of the country's most in-demand DJs over the last year. The Ghanian-Filipina artist kickstarted her career with a Boiler Room set at Sugar Mountain in December 2022, and since then, she's toured around Europe (and debuted at Dekmantel), becoming known for digging deep into her musical ancestry and weaving amapiano and Afro-electronic sounds creatively through her sets. In this interview recorded live at Pitch Music and Arts Festival, Frimpong talks to journalist Tanya Akinola about "air DJing" in her bedroom before being able to afford gear, and how her career has skyrocketed at such a rapid rate. Even though she hasn't been a name on the stage for a long time, she's managed to carve out a unique space for the QTBIPOC community with the party she co-runs, Dutty, which she says is for people who can relate to the afro-diaspora or who just want to open their minds to it.
